比特币挖矿:探索数字货币世界的前沿之旅
在当今数字化的时代,比特币作为一种备受瞩目的数字货币,引发了广泛的关注和讨论。而比特币挖矿,则是比特币生态系统中至关重要的一环,它不仅关乎比特币的产生和流通,更蕴含着复杂的技术原理和经济逻辑。本文将深入探讨比特币挖矿的各个方面,带领读者领略这一独特领域的奥秘。
一、比特币挖矿的基本概念
比特币挖矿,简单来说,就是通过计算机的算力来解决特定的数学难题,从而验证比特币交易并获得新的比特币奖励的过程。在比特币网络中,交易信息被打包成一个个的区块,矿工们的任务就是对这些区块进行验证和打包,确保交易的真实性和有效性。
这个数学难题基于哈希函数的特性。哈希函数是一种将任意长度的数据转换为固定长度哈希值的函数,具有单向性和不可逆性。在比特币挖矿中,矿工们需要找到一个特定的随机数(nonce),使得该区块的哈希值满足一定的条件,例如哈希值的前若干位为0。这个过程需要不断地尝试不同的随机数,进行大量的计算,直到找到符合条件的解为止。
二、比特币挖矿的硬件设备
早期,比特币挖矿可以依靠普通的个人电脑进行,但随着比特币网络难度的不断增加,对算力的要求也越来越高,专业的挖矿设备应运而生。
三、比特币挖矿的算法与难度调整机制
比特币挖矿使用的算法是SHA-256,这是一种安全哈希算法,具有很强的抗碰撞性和单向性。SHA-256算法的复杂性保证了比特币网络的安全性,使得攻击者很难通过篡改交易信息来获取不当利益。
为了保持比特币的发行速度和网络安全,比特币网络采用了难度调整机制。大约每两周的时间(即2016个区块),比特币网络会根据过去两周内矿工的挖矿难度和出块情况进行一次难度调整。如果过去两周内平均每10分钟产生的区块数多于预期的1个,那么难度就会增加,使得矿工找到符合条件的解更加困难;反之,如果平均每10分钟产生的区块数少于1个,难度就会降低。
四、比特币挖矿的经济影响
比特币挖矿不仅仅是一个技术问题,还涉及到复杂的经济因素。
五、比特币挖矿面临的挑战与未来发展
比特币挖矿在发展过程中也面临着诸多挑战。
首先,随着比特币的普及和市场的发展,挖矿难度不断增加,对矿工的技术和资金实力提出了更高的要求。其次,监管政策的不确定性也给比特币挖矿带来了一定的风险。不同国家和地区对比特币的态度和政策各不相同,一些国家对挖矿活动进行了严格的限制或监管。
然而,比特币挖矿的未来依然充满希望。随着技术的不断进步,挖矿设备的性能将不断提高,能源利用效率也将得到进一步提升。同时,比特币作为一种去中心化的数字货币,在全球范围内具有广阔的应用前景,这将吸引更多的投资者和矿工参与到比特币挖矿中来。
比特币挖矿是比特币生态系统中的重要组成部分,它不仅涉及到复杂的技术原理和经济逻辑,还对能源、环境和社会经济等方面产生了深远的影响。尽管在发展过程中面临着诸多挑战,但随着技术的不断进步和市场的不断发展,比特币挖矿的未来依然值得期待。我们相信,在未来,比特币挖矿将在数字经济领域发挥更加重要的作用,为人类社会的发展做出更大的贡献。